Planned Unit Development District
The purpose of planned unit development regulations is to encourage flexibility in the design and development of land in order to promote its most appropriate use; to facilitate the adequate and economical provision of streets, utilities and public spaces; and to preserve the natural and scenic qualities of open areas.; The procedure is intended to permit diversification in the location of structures and improve circulation facilities and other site qualities while ensuring adequate standards relating to public health, safety, comfort, order, appearance, convenience, morals and general welfare both in the use and occupancy of buildings and facilities in planned groups.
